Commission study shows renewables’ positive economic impact

22.06.2009

The full version of the European Commission’s report on ‘The impact of renewable energy policy on economic growth and employment in the European Union has now been launched.’

Overall, the report states that policies that support renewable energy sources give a significant boost to the economy and the number of jobs in the EU. It finds that the total gross employment in the renewables sector in the EU-27 in 2020 would amount to between 2.3 million and 2.8 million people. The net GDP change due to renewable energy policies in 2020 is expected to amount to between 0.11% and 0.44% for the EU-27.
